Is anyone else having problems posting comments?

Finally today, I made the rounds on some of my favorite blogs.  I visited most of my faithful commenters, really I did.  I signed in and commented.  It asked me to choose a profile.  I did and signed in again.  It took me back to my comment and then when I pushed the button...back to the sign in again.  What a vicious circle that was!  I tried signing with my normal email and tried signing in with my Google account.

Can anyone please help me?

Angela said…
This has been happening to a lot of us lately. It helped me when it takes you to sign in, make sure you do NOT check the keep signed in box. Don't know what it did, but then I could comment. A sweet blogging friend told me that it worked for her and I tried it and it was working for me. Give that a try and hopefully it will help you too. Have a great evening.
Gosh, many, many of us have been having this problem.
We have found that if you keep yourself SIGNED OUT then it will work.
Try it and see how that works.

Teresa said…
I had the same problem and was told to unclick the keep signed in box when you sign into google. This has made all the difference for me.
